A recent report from JPMorgan has tempered the optimistic outlook for stablecoin market capitalization growth. While the usage of stablecoins continues to surge, the bank warns that the total market cap will not expand at the same pace, largely due to a structural shift in how stablecoins circulate.

Velocity Effect: Same Capital, More Transactions

The report highlights a key concept: stablecoin velocity. As stablecoins are increasingly used for payments, cross-border transfers, and DeFi protocols, the same unit of stablecoin is being reused multiple times within a given period. This improved efficiency means that the overall market cap does not need to grow proportionally with transaction volume. In other words, faster velocity reduces the demand for newly minted tokens to accommodate growing usage.

2028 Market Cap Forecast: $500-600 Billion

Based on current trends, JPMorgan estimates that the total stablecoin market capitalization will reach between $500 billion and $600 billion by 2028. This projection stands in stark contrast to more bullish predictions of a $1 trillion market within the same timeframe, which the bank deems overly optimistic. The report cautions that many analysts fail to account for the dampening effect of velocity on capital requirements.

The bank acknowledges that higher velocity is a sign of real-world adoption, particularly in merchant payments and remittances. Stablecoins are moving beyond mere trading pairs and becoming a medium of exchange. However, the financial institution advises investors to focus on usage metrics rather than raw market cap growth when evaluating the health of the stablecoin ecosystem.

Yet JPMorgan's analysis suggests that market cap expansion will be more measured, and that a trillion-dollar stablecoin market remains a distant milestone without a significant reduction in velocity or a massive inflow of new collateral assets.
